AI Security Risks Shift Focus to Browser Frontline

Summary

AI-powered attacks and the adoption of shadow AI are introducing new security risks within web browsers. Push Security highlights the importance of browser visibility for effective threat detection and AI governance.

Key Points

  • AI-powered attacks are increasingly targeting web browsers, making them a critical point for security measures.
  • Shadow AI, or unauthorized AI applications, are being adopted without proper oversight, increasing security vulnerabilities.
  • Push Security emphasizes the necessity of browser visibility to detect threats and manage AI governance effectively.
  • The article underscores the role of browsers as a frontline in the battle against AI-related security threats.
